Scarce LP with a bit of a buzz... Mostly Loner Folk Rock, I guess, with some Prog and Psych Touches...Sounds a LOT like Peter Hammill to me..."STEPHEN WHYNOTT: From Philly To Tablas"

From "Music Is Medicine" Small Label Records, 1977.... Seattle Label, recorded in Boston, #MIM 9001.... With Stephen WHynott, Zed Mclarnon, and Dan Frye.... Selections are: "RETREAT SUITE, WHAT HAVE YOU SEEN, ALTITUDE, RAIN SWOLLEN HIGHWAY, NINE DAY SUNFLOWER, WITHOUT US, GO AROUND, SNOWS EDGE, MEXICAN OIL, OH BOY I'VE WON THE CONTEST AT LAST" Condition of the jacket; VG or VG+, cut-corner , light wear/ soil. Condition of the vinyl; VG++/NM, fresh...ORIGINAL Small Label 70s Folk- Prog Oddity!
